I was quoted $360 here for the ceiling fan. In JB I got it for RM480. The only thing missing is the ceiling hook which you have to get your electrician to supply.

Also got 2 wall fans, $160 here, RM200 there.

This applies to KDK and Panasonic - which is actually the same thing under different brands.
